Buying Guide for the Best Two Way Radios

Two-way radios, also known as walkie-talkies, are essential tools for communication in various scenarios, such as outdoor adventures, business operations, and emergency situations. Choosing the right two-way radio involves understanding your specific needs and the key specifications that determine the performance and suitability of the device. Here are the key specs you should consider when selecting a two-way radio and how to navigate them to find the best fit for you.
Frequency BandThe frequency band determines the range and clarity of communication. Two-way radios typically operate on either Very High Frequency (VHF) or Ultra High Frequency (UHF) bands. VHF radios are better for outdoor use with fewer obstructions, as they have a longer range in open areas. UHF radios, on the other hand, are more suitable for indoor use or urban environments with many obstacles, as they can penetrate walls and buildings more effectively. Choose VHF for outdoor activities like hiking or farming, and UHF for indoor or mixed environments like warehouses or city use.
RangeThe range of a two-way radio indicates the maximum distance over which it can communicate effectively. This range can vary significantly based on the environment. In open areas, some radios can reach up to 30 miles, while in urban settings with many obstructions, the range might be reduced to a few miles. Consider where you will be using the radios most frequently. For outdoor adventures or large properties, opt for a model with a longer range. For indoor or short-distance communication, a shorter range may suffice.
ChannelsChannels allow users to communicate on different frequencies, reducing interference and enabling private conversations. Basic models may have a few channels, while advanced models can have hundreds. More channels provide greater flexibility and privacy, especially in crowded areas where many people might be using two-way radios. If you need to coordinate with multiple groups or require secure communication, choose a radio with more channels. For simpler, one-on-one communication, fewer channels will be adequate.
Battery LifeBattery life is crucial, especially for extended use. Two-way radios can come with rechargeable batteries or disposable ones. Rechargeable batteries are more cost-effective and environmentally friendly, while disposable batteries can be convenient for emergencies. Consider how long you will need the radio to operate between charges. For long trips or all-day use, look for models with longer battery life or the option to carry spare batteries. For occasional use, shorter battery life may be acceptable.
DurabilityDurability is important if you plan to use the radios in harsh conditions. Look for radios with rugged designs, water resistance, and dustproof features. These are essential for outdoor activities, construction sites, or any environment where the radios might be exposed to the elements. If you need a radio for casual or indoor use, durability might be less of a concern, but it's still worth considering for overall longevity.
Additional FeaturesAdditional features can enhance the functionality of your two-way radio. These may include weather alerts, GPS, hands-free operation, and emergency call functions. Think about which features will be most useful for your specific needs. For example, weather alerts are great for outdoor enthusiasts, while hands-free operation can be beneficial for busy work environments. Prioritize the features that will add the most value to your use case.
